How long do corporate bonds last?

Term lengths for corporate bonds can range from one to 30 years, but they are generally classified as: Long term (more than 10 years). Bonds with longer terms usually offer higher interest payments to entice investors to tie up their money for an extended period.

What is a maturity date on a bond?

Maturity dates can be as short as one day or can extend for 30 years or longer. Battifarano says the bond issuer will make regular interest payments on the bond until it matures, whether the borrower is a corporation, the U.S. Treasury, a municipality or other entity.

Can I sell corporate bonds before maturity?

If you want to sell your corporate bonds prior to maturity, Vanguard Brokerage can provide access to a secondary over-the-counter market. The large market size for outstanding corporate bonds generally provides liquidity, but liquidity will vary depending on a bond’s features, credit rating, lot size, and other market conditions.
